Takes a set of important theoretical approaches, including Genette, Barthes, Bakhtin & Reader Response criticism, & applies them in close readings of 8 key American novels from the period 1880 to 1940. This series of novels moves from James's The Portrait of a LadyÓ to Hurston's Their Eyes Were Watching God.Ó Also includes Twain's Huckleberry Finn,Ó Wharton's The House of Mirth,Ó Cather's A Lost Lady,Ó Hemingway's The Sun Also Rises,Ó Faulkner's The Sound & the Fury, & Fitzgerald's The Great Gatsby.Ó These perennially popular novels appear on many American Literature survey courses & the careful application of theory to texts makes this the ideal book for students when first introduced to the concept of narrative theory.Messent, Peter is the author of 'New Readings of the American Novel Narrative Theory and Its Application', published 1998 under ISBN 9780756774776 and ISBN 0756774772.
